MATERIALS
Yarn: I used K&C yarn (RIP Joann Fabrics) in size 3; Sequoia, Succulent, Grassy Knoll, and Buttercup, and Bernat Softee lightweight size 3 yarn in; Soft Peach, Lavender, and White, and Pound of Love size 4; black.
Hook Size: 4.0 mm
Stuffing (polyfill, cotton wool, etc.)
Tapestry needle for sewing
Scissors
Pins (optional)
ABBREVIATIONS – US TERMS
Ch – chain
Sc – single crochet
Inc – increase
Dec – decrease
Stsl – slip stitch
Hdc – half double crochet
Dc – double crochet
Ibl = in both loops
3max = sc 3 in next st
3min = dec next 3 st into 1
INSTRUCTIONS
~Start with hand pocket and body~ Start with Pound of Love Black
Round 1: sc 6 in magic loop (6)
Round 2: inc in each st around (12)
Round 3: (inc, sc) 6 times (18)
Round 4: (inc, sc 2) 6 times (24)
Round 5: (inc 3, sc 9) 2 times (30)
Round 6 – 29 (23 rounds) sc in each st around (30)
Switch to K&C Succulent
Round 30: sc around (30)
Round 28: (ch 18, sk 4 st, sc in next 12 st) 2 times (52)
Round 29 – 54 (26 rounds): sc around(52)
Slst in next st and fasten off.
~Head~ - Make with K&C Sequoia
Round 1: sc 4 into magic loop (4)
Round 2: sc 3 around (12)
Round 3: sc 1, (3max, sc 2) 3 times, 3max, sc 1 (20)
Round 4: sc 2, (3max, sc 4) 3 times, 3max, sc 2 (24)
Round 5: sc 3, (3max, sc 6) 3 times, 3max, sc 3 (36)
Round 6: sc 4, (3max, sc 8) 3 times, 3max, sc 4 (44)
Round 7: sc 5, (3max, sc 10) 3 times, 3max, sc 5 (52)
Round 8: sc 6, (3max, sc 12) 3 times, 3max, sc 6 (60)
Round 9: sc 7, (3max, sc 14) 3 times, 3max, sc 7 (68)
Round 10: sc 8, (3max, sc 16) 3 times, 3max, sc 8 (76)
Round 11: sc 9, (3max, sc 18) 3 times, 3max, sc 9 (84)
Round 12: sc 10, (3max, sc 20) 3 times, 3max, sc 10 (92)
Round 13 – 32 (20 rounds) sc around (108)
Round 33: sc 10, (3min, sc 20) 3 times, 3min, sc 10 (92)
Round 34: sc 9, (3min, sc 18) 3 times, 3min, sc 9 (84)
Round 35: sc 8, (3min, sc 16) 3 times, 3min, sc 8 (76)
Round 36: sc 7, (3min, sc 14) 3 times, 3min, sc 7 (68)
Round 37: sc 6, (3min, sc 12) 3 times, 3min, sc 6 (60)
Round 38: sc 5, (3min, sc 10) 3 times, 3min, sc 5 (52)
Round 39: sc 4, (3min, sc 8) 3 times, 3min, sc 4 (44)
Round 40: sc 3, (3min, sc 6) 3 times, 3min, sc 3 (36)
Round 41: (dec, sc 4) 6 times (30)
Slst in next st and fasten off with long tail for sewing.
Using long tail, firmly sew bottom of head to hand pocket where Black and Succulent yarns meet, stuffing empty space of head with polyfill as you secure the head to the body. This may take a lot of maneuvering the polyfill around to stuff the head good while not smushing the hand pocket inside.
When head is firmly sewn on body, use the head’s magic loop tail to attach top center of hand pocket to top of head to keep in place.
~Arms~ – Make 2 and start with K&C Sequoia
Round 1: sc 8 in magic loop (8)
Round 2: inc in each st around (16)
Round 3: (inc, sc in next 3 st) 4 times (20)
Round 4 – 7 (4 rounds): sc in each st (20)
Switch to K&C Grassy Knoll
Round 8 – 17 (10 rounds): sc in each st around (20)
Round 18: (inc, sc 9) 2 times (22)
Fasten off with tail for sewing
Line up each arm with arm holes in hand pocket and sew tightly together.
~Ears~ – make 2 with K&C Sequoia
Round 1: sc 6 in magic loop (6)
Round 2: inc around (12)
Round 3: (inc, sc) 6 times (18)
Round 4: (inc, sc 2) 6 times (24)
Round 5: (inc, sc 3) 6 times (30)
Round 6 – 9 (4 rounds): sc around (30)
Round 10: (dec, sc 3) 6 times (24)
Round 11: (dec, sc 2) 6 times (18)
Stuff with polyfill
Round 12: (dec, sc) 6 times (12)
Fasten off with tail for sewing.
Sew each ear on sides of head around top head edge, pinning base to head prior to sewing, if needed.
~Glasses~ – make 2 and start with Softee White
Row 1: sc and sc across starting in 1st ch from hook (8) ch 1 and turn
Row 2 – 5 (4 rows): sc across (8) and turn
With Pound of Love Black, 3max in last st, sc 6, 3max in 8th st. (This will form frames) Sc along short side of lens (3 st). Along other long end, 3max in next st, sc 6, 3max, and sc up other short end (3 st) Fasten off with long tail for sewing to face.
To form glasses nose bridge, use one black tail to sc along short end of frame and turn. Repeat once. Sew bridge to other lens frame to form glasses. Use each tail to sew glasses to face, in back loop only, directly centered to face, pinning glasses to head prior to sewing, if needed.
~Nose~ – make with Pound of Love Black
Round 1: in magic loop, slst, (hdc 2, slst 2) 2 times, hdc 2, slst. Pull magic loop tight to form nose. Fasten off with tail for sewing.
Position nose in between glasses, just barely meeting top of nose with bottom of nose bridge. Use tail to sew nose to face, using pins to position prior to sewing, if needed.
~Shirt collar~ – make with Softee White and start with long tail
Row 1: sc 45 and sc across starting in 1st ch from hook (45) and turn
Row 2: inc, sc 43, inc (47) and turn
Row 3: sc across (47) and turn
Row 4: inc, sc 45, inc (49) and turn
Row 5: sc across (49) and turn
Row 6: inc, sc 47, inc (51) and turn
Row 7: sc across (51) and turn
Fasten off and hide tail
Use long starting tail to securely sew the first row of collar around neck, where green and brown yarn meet.
~Tie~ - Start with K&C Buttercup
Round 1: sc 6 in magic loop (6)
Round 2: inc around (12)
Round 3: (inc, sc 5) 2 times (14)
Round 4: sc around (14)
Switch to K&C Sequoia
Round 5: sc around (14)
Round 6: (dec, sc 5) 2 times (12)
Round 7: dec around (6)
Switch to K&C Buttercup. Rounds switch to rows.
Row 8: sc 3 (3) and turn
Row 9: inc, sc, inc (5) and turn
Row 10: dc, hdc, sc (switch to brown) sc 2 (5) and turn
Row 11: dc, hdc, sc 3 (5) and turn
Row 12: inc, sc 3, inc (7) and turn
Row 13: sc across (7) and turn
Row 14: dc, hdc sc, (switch to yellow) sc 4 (7) and turn
Row 15: inc, sc 5, inc (9) and turn
Row 16: dec, sc 5, dec (7) and turn
Row 17: sc across (7) and turn
Row 18: dc dec, hdc, sc (switch to brown) sc, dec (5) and turn
Row 19: dc dec, hdc, dec (3) and turn
Row 20: dec, sc (2) and turn
Row 21: dec and fasten off
Sew base “knot” of tie at neck, in between each end of the shirt collar.
~Suitcase~ – make 2 using Softee Peach
Round 1: sc 6 in magic loop (6)
Round 2: sc, inc 2, sc, inc 2 (10)
Round 3: (sc 1, 3max) 2 times, sc 2, (3max, sc 1) 2 times (18)
Round 4: sc 2, 3max, sc 3, 3max, sc 4, 3max, sc 3, 3max, sc 2 (26)
Round 5: sc 3, 3max, sc 5, 3max, sc 6, 3max, sc 5, 3max, sc 3 (34)
Round 6: sc 4, 3max, sc 7, 3max, sc 8, 3max, sc 7, 3max, sc 4 (42)
Round 7: sc 5, 3max, sc 9, 3max, sc 10, 3max, sc 9, 3max, sc 5 (50)
Round 8: sc 7, in flo sc 11, ibl sc 14, in flo, sc 11, ibl sc 7 (50)
Round 9 – 10 (2 rounds): sc around (50)
Ch 15, sk 3, sc 2 in next st, sc back along ch and fasten off
To form the bottom hinge of suitcase, use tail to securely sew the bottom edge of each suitcase piece together.
~Suitcase flower~
~Petals~ – make with Softee Lavender
In magic loop: (sc, hdc, dc, hdc, sc, slst) 4 times. Fasten off with tail for sewing edges to suitcase
~Pistil~ – make with K&C Buttercup
In magic loop, sc 6 and fasten off with tail for sewing on petals.
Use pistil tail to sew to petals and fasten off, then use petal tail to sew flower to suitcase.
~Suitcase Handle~ – make with K&C Sequoia
Row 1: ch 20 and sc back across (20). Sew each end to suitcase handles to wrap around arm for legal document transport capabilities.
And with that, Browny Bear is ready for the courtroom!
